How did the mothers of the plaza de mayo help establish democracy in Argentina?

Madres of the Plaza de Mayo. During the “Dirty War” in Argentina, waged from 1976 to 1983, the military government abducted, tortured, and killed left-wing militants, and anyone they claimed were “subversives,” including all political opponents of the regime.
